Women's Basketball to Host Play4Kay Game on Wednesday, Jan. 23

New York, N.Y. – The City College of New York women's basketball team will host Play4Kay on Wednesday, Jan. 23 against Baruch College at the Nat Holman Gymnasium. Tip-off against the Bearcats is set for 5:00 p.m. 

The program has set a goal to raise $500.00.  All funds collected online will go directly to support cancer research through the Kay Yow Cancer Fund.

About Play4Kay
The Kay Yow Cancer Fund is a charitable organization committed to being a part of finding an answer in the fight against women's cancers through raising money for scientific research, assisting the underserved and unifying people for a common cause. Since its founding in 2007 in honor of former North Carolina State head coach Kay Yow, $5.38 million has been granted for scientific research and related programs focused on women's cancers. The "pink phenomenon" in women's basketball began during the 2004-05 season, and Play4Kay was originally called Think Pink and Pink Zone.
